Koppers Coke

1932

Victoria Hutson Huntley

Associated Names
Victoria Hutson Huntley

Artist, American, 1900 - 1971

The image shows an industrial landscape with tall smokestacks, industrial buildings, and a bridge. The painting technique is meticulous, with a stippled texture for detail. The color palette is monochromatic with shades of black, white, and gray. A waterway is depicted with reflections and a sign suggesting human presence. Smoke is rising into the sky, adding movement to the scene.

Inscriptions

Inscribed: In pencil: lower left, For Hollis Holbrook; lower right, Victoria Hutson 1932; bottom left margin, Kopper's Coke - Edition low; bottom center, For The Julius Rosenwald jury on Grants.; bottom right, 25.00.
